MTB riders and trail runners give thumbs up to Gaan Wild at Lekwena

The Potchefstroom Chamber of Commerce organised this event to promote tourism in Potchefstroom and give riders and runners the opportunity to experience the stunning beauty on their doorstep at Lekwena Wildlife Estate.

Some of the top local mountain biking and trail runners put it all on the line during the third edition of the Gaan Wild Mountain Bike and Trail Run at the Lekwena Wildlife Estate from 1 to 2 May.

Here are the results of the week-end:

24 km trail run winners:

In the female category:

  1. Jackie Maritz
  2. Santie Crots
  3. Wida de Klerk and Tara Walmsley.

In the male category:

  1. Dikotsi Lekopa
  2. Isaac Mogapi
  3. Hermann Venter and Maritz Marius.

15 km trail run winners:

In the female category:

  1. Jodean Rosin
  2. Thandi Mosiiko
  3. Jenine Smith.

In the male category:

  1. Obed Natheolana
  2. Tolo Mooketsi
  3. Kleinboy Mashile.

6 km trail run winners:

In the female category:

  1. Ellen Luche van der Berg
  2. Dane Maritz
  3. Tume Van Niekerk.

In the male category:

  1. Ashton Didericks
  2. John van der Berg
  3. Nelvin Didericks.

87 km MTB winners:

In the female category:

  1. Karlise Scheepers
  2. Anine Jordaan
  3. Christelle Snyman.

In the male category:

  1. Marc Pritzen
  2. Pieter du Toit
  3. Jaco Van Dyk.

60 km MTB winners:

In the female category:

  1. Danielle Strydom
  2. Jodean Rosin
  3. Joné Van Eeden.

In the male category:

  1. Herman Mare
  2. Frans Van Der Berg
  3. Paul Delicado.

42 km MTB winners:

In the female category:

  1. Zanri Grobbelaar
  2. Anneke Van Rooyen
  3. Linke Beckley.

In the male category:

  1. Ryno Schutte
  2. Thinus Maritz
  3. Thomas-Ross Patterson.

20 km MTB winners:

In the female category:

  1. Ismé Pretorius
  2. Melissa Meyer
  3. SueYen Nel.

In the male category:

  1. MJ Potgieter
  2. Reuben Jonker
  3. Henri Jonker.
